Cheapest Available Mill Pond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in the Mill Pond area of Burlington, MA is a 1 Bed unit found at 55+ Apartments priced from $1,695. Beacon Village has the second lowest priced unit, which is a Studio apartment currently listed from $1,830. Here are the most affordable Mill Pond apartments for rent in Burlington, MA:

Apartment ListingModel NameBed/BathPriced From
55+ Apartments1 Bedroom1BR,1BA$1,695
Beacon VillageAppletonStudio,1BA$1,830
Kimball CourtOne Bed One Bath1BR,1BA$2,049
Westgate ApartmentsOne Bedroom1BR,1BA$2,050
Halstead BurlingtonA1 AFF Income Restricted1BR,1BA$2,250
